<--Created 11 April 2020--> A bookplate by Gleeson White for Emma Chamberlayne
Bookplate for Emma Chamberlayne

Bookplate for Emma Chamberlayne

Gleeson White

Late 1890s; signed.

Pen and pencil on paper.

Another of Gleeson White’s fruit-bearing designs, with vibrant twisting roots reinforcing the idea of vital growth and development. The whole is further animated by the swirling banner and all of the visual elements embody the motto: ‘Accomplish rather than be conspicuous’.
